UPDATED Instructions on how to make a Cardboard Selfie

  1. Find a sturdy piece of cardboard that’s approximately 12” wide by 24” tall.   CAN BE TALLER THAN THIS!
  2. Draw a body shape with pencil the cardboard and cut out with scissors. See some of the examples, below.
  3. You do not need to mount your cardboard selfie on a stick.
  4. Draw or paint facial features. Dress your person with paint, paper, fabric, yarn, etc.  Whatever you have on hand. The more colorful the better! Keep it simple and fun.
  5. Be sure to glue the details securely to your cardboard cutout.
  6. Write your first and last name on the back of your person!  If you have a preference for where you’d like your cardboard selfie to sit, please note that on the back too. We’ll try and do our best.
